Charge couvert is correct? Understand

In doubt whether or not it is correct to charge couvert, many consumers end up paying the rate in bars and restaurants. But did you know that the establishment can not oblige the customer to pay if he has not previously informed about charging? According to the Consumer Protection Code, the practice violates one of the main rights, provided for in legislation, that of information.

This notice, which must also be in a visible place, must be done so that the consumer does not think it is the courtesy. Another form of couvert very common, in these establishments, is the artistic one. According to the Brazilian Association of Consumer Protection (Protest), the correct thing is that, at the entrance, ask the client if he has an interest in watching the show. "Otherwise, delivering a product or service without your request equates to the free sample, which means you are not required to pay."

Green light

Couvert de entrada: It can be charged when the establishment offers the appetizers before the main course, as long as it is informed the value of clearly and ostentatious of the service items.

Artistic Couvert: Can be charged when the establishment consults the consumer about the interest of attending or not the musical presentation, soon upon arrival. The value should also be clearly and accessible to customers.
